How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Georgetown?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Georgetown Studio Apartments | $2,025 | $1,595 | $2,570 |
| Georgetown 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,402 | $1,331 | $3,200 |
| Georgetown 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,018 | $1,920 | $4,824 |
| Georgetown 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,536 | $2,300 | $4,470 |

Largest Available Georgetown and Nearby Studio Apartments
The largest available Studio apartment unit in Georgetown, MA is found at Washington Mill in the Colonial Heights neighborhood and is 995 square feet priced from $2,038. The Cordovan at Haverhill Station in the Downtown Haverhill neighborhood has the second largest Studio, which is sized at 660 square feet and currently listed start at $1,870. Here is today’s list of the largest available Studio units in Georgetown: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Washington Mill | Atelier Studio | 995 Sq Ft | $2,038 |
| The Cordovan at Haverhill Station | Studio | 660 Sq Ft | $1,870 |
| The Beck | S1 | 505 Sq Ft | $1,950 |
Cheapest Available Georgetown and Nearby Studio Apartments
As of June 10, 2026 the lowest priced Studio apartment unit in Georgetown, MA is the Studio Model starting from $1,870 at The Cordovan at Haverhill Station in the Downtown Haverhill neighborhood. The second most affordable Georgetown Studio is the Studios Model at Washington Mill starting at $1,943 in the Colonial Heights neighborhood. The average price for all Studio apartments in Georgetown is currently $2,025.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available Studio options in Georgetown: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| The Cordovan at Haverhill Station | Studio | $1,870 |
| Washington Mill | Studios | $1,943 |
| The Beck | S1 | $1,950 |
